The Effect of Auricular Massage on Naso-Oral Suctioning Procedural Pain in Premature Neonates: A Randomized

Background:
In the neonatal intensive care unit (NICU), premature neonates frequently endure painful procedures that can lead to long-lasting sequelae, underscoring the critical need for safe and effective pain management strategies. Auricular massage has demonstrated significant benefits for children, including anxiety and stress relief. Investigating its effectiveness in alleviating pain in neonates could introduce a valuable nonpharmacological approach to pain management, enhancing the overall care and comfort of these vulnerable infants.
Objective:
This research is aimed at studying the effectiveness of a 3-min session of auricular massage in reducing pain caused by nasal and oral suctioning among premature neonates in the NICU in Jordan.
Methods:
A randomized controlled trial employing a single-blind crossover design was conducted in a single hospital. Preterm neonates were randomly assigned to one of two conditions. In Condition I, neonates initially received auricular massage treatment after suctioning, followed, after 2 days, by no massage after suctioning. Conversely, in Condition II, neonates had the reversed sequence, starting with no massage and then receiving auricular massage treatment after 2 days. Pain levels in the neonates were assessed using the Premature Infant Pain Profile-Revised (PIPP-R) scale.
Results:
Data from 60 preterm neonates were analyzed using the SPSS Version 28. Chi-square and independent t-tests revealed no significant differences between neonates in the study conditions based on gender (p = 0.43), gestational age (p = 0.41), and body weight (p = 0.35). Paired t-test results indicated a significant difference in pain scores when comparing periods of auricular massage to periods without massage. The mean pain score following auricular massage was 3.63 (SD = 2.36), whereas it was 10.23 (SD = 2.40) in the absence of massage.
Conclusion:
Auricular massage for a 3-min duration is an effective nursing intervention that warrants consideration as a nonpharmacological method of pain relief for premature neonates during admission to the NICU.
